What is the TheMealDB Alternative MCP Server?
Connect TheMealDB open database to any AI agent and instantly search recipes, browse ingredients, and discover meals from global cuisines.
What you can do
- Recipe Search — Search for meals by name and retrieve complete recipes with ingredients and step-by-step instructions
- Cuisine Discovery — Filter meals by cuisine area (Italian, Indian, Mexican, etc.)
- Category Browsing — Explore meals organized by category (Beef, Chicken, Seafood, Dessert, etc.)
- Ingredient Lookup — Find meals by main ingredient and discover all available ingredients
- Random Inspiration — Get random meal suggestions for culinary inspiration
How it works
- Subscribe to this server
- No API key required — TheMealDB is free and open
- Start searching recipes from Claude, Cursor, or any MCP-compatible client

What is Agent mode and why does it matter for MCP?
Agent mode is Cursor's autonomous execution mode where the AI can perform multi-step tasks: reading files, editing code, running terminal commands, and calling MCP tools. Without Agent mode, Cursor operates in a simpler ask-and-answer mode that doesn't support tool calling. Always ensure you're in Agent mode when working with MCP servers.
Where does Cursor store MCP configuration?
Cursor looks for MCP server configurations in a mcp.json file. You can configure servers at the project level (.cursor/mcp.json in your project root) or globally (~/.cursor/mcp.json). Project-level configs take precedence.
Can Cursor use MCP tools in inline edits?
No. MCP tools are only available in Agent mode through the chat panel. Inline completions and Tab suggestions do not trigger MCP tool calls. This is by design. tool calls require user visibility and approval.
How do I verify MCP tools are loaded?
Open Settings → Features → MCP and look for your server name. A green indicator means the server is connected. You can also check Agent mode's available tools by clicking the tools dropdown in the chat panel.
Tools not appearing in Cursor
Ensure you are in Agent mode (not Ask mode). MCP tools only work in Agent mode.
Server shows as disconnected
Check Settings → Features → MCP and verify the server status. Try clicking the refresh button.
